Sistemas operacionais
Por: Rodrigo.Claudino • 22/4/2018 • 1.045 Palavras (5 Páginas) • 2.442 Visualizações
...
Fragmentação interna na Partição do Processo 1:
Fragmentação interna na Partição do Processo 2:
Fragmentação externa:
No instante de tempo 5: O processo 1 termina sua execução.
Sistema Operacional
20kb
Área Livre
20kb
Partição do Processo 2
4kb
Área Livre
20kb
Fragmentação interna na Partição do Processo 2:
Fragmentação externa:
No instante de tempo 10: O processo 2 termina sua execução.
Sistema Operacional
20kb
Partição do Processo 3
36kb
Área Livre
8kb
Fragmentação interna na Partição do Processo 3:
Fragmentação externa:
- Considerando as estratégias para escolha da partição dinamicamente, conceitue as estratégias best-fit e worst-fit especificando prós e contras de cada uma.
R: Best-fit deixa um espaço menor espaço sem utilização porém tende a deixa a memória com muitas áreas livres não contíguas, Worst-Fit deixa o maior espaço sem utilização
- Considere um sistema que possua as seguintes área livres na memória principal, ordenadas crescentemente: 10Kb, 4Kb, 20Kb, 18Kb, 7Kb, 9Kb, 12Kb e 15Kb. Para cada programa abaixo, qual seria a partição alocada utilizando-se as estratégias first-fit, best-fit e worst-fit?
- 12Kb
- 10Kb
- 9Kb
First-fit:
- 12kb – 20kb
- 10kb – 10kb
- 9kb – 10kb
Best-fit:
- 12kb – 12kb
- 10kb – 10kb
- 9kb – 9kb
Worst-fit:
- 12kb – 20kb
- 10kb – 18kb
- 9kb – 15kb
---------------------------------------------------------------
- Um sistema utiliza alocação particionada dinâmica como mecanismo de gerência de memória. O sistema operacional aloca uma área de memória total de 50Kb e possui, inicialmente, os programas da tabela a seguir:
5 Kb
Programa A
3 Kb
Programa B
10 Kb
Livre
6 Kb
Programa C
26 Kb
Livre
Realize as operações abaixo sequencialmente, mostrando o estado da memória após cada uma delas. Resolva a questão utilizando as estratégias best-fit, worst-fit e first-fit.
a) alocar uma área para o programa D que possui 6 Kb;
b) liberar a área do programa A;
c) alocar uma área para o programa E que possui 4 Kb.
Best-fit:
a) alocar uma área para o programa D que possui 6 Kb;
5kb
P A
3kb
P B
6kb
P D
4kb
Livre
6kb
P C
26kb
Livre
b) liberar a área do programa A;
5kb
Livre
3kb
P B
6kb
P D
4kb
Livre
6kb
P C
26kb
Livre
c) alocar uma área para o programa E que possui 4 Kb.
5kb
Livre
3kb
P B
6kb
P D
4kb
P E
6kb
P C
26kb
Livre
Worst-fit:
a) alocar uma área para o programa D que possui 6 Kb;
5kb
P A
3kb
P B
10kb
Livre
6kb
P C
...